(ANSA) - VENICE, DECEMBER 19 - He returned to the Galleriedof the Academy of Venice, after being exhibited at the Louvredi Paris, the "Vitruvian Man" by Leonardo Da Vinci. The return journey ended yesterday, under the supervision of Director Giulio Manieri Elia. The famous drawing was exhibited at the Louvre from October 24th to December 16th, occasionally in the exhibition 'Leonard de Vinci' dedicated to the Tuscan genius for the 500th anniversary of his death, and which continues until February 24th. Against the loan to France a complaint had been made against the Veneto Regional Court, which had been rejected. The Galleriedof the Academy are developing some initiatives for the development of design, and expose the Vitruvian Man every year for a limited period of time. A permanent space dedicated to the complexity of the design and its contents will also be designed, through the use of advanced technologies for virtual fruition, when the original sheet cannot be displayed.
